In the large variety of models such as 3D and 2D Fermi-gas model with hard-core repulsion, 3D and 2D Hubbard model, and Shubin–Vonsovsky model we demonstrate the possibility of triplet p-wave pairing at low electron density. We show that the critical temperature of the p-wave pairing can be strongly increased in a spinpolarized case or in a two-band situation already at low density and reach experimentally observable values of (1–5) K. We also discuss briefly d-wave pairing and high-Tc superconductivity with Tc ~ 100 K which arises in the extended Hubbard model and in the generalized t-J model close to half-filling.
